I just bought a pre-accutrigger savage 110 tactical 25-06 really clean gun . I am going to make this my truck gun and wanted to get a thought on some lighter loads for coyotes and hogs. I have another 25-06 that I load for deer and big game so I have that covered with 117 grain hornady sst. I am thinking something like nosler 85 grain ballistic tips . What do you guys think?
 
I get over 3600fps with 85gr Nosler BT's and 54.5gr RL17. What
do ya think about THAT??

I've used 75 v-max on coyotes and they get a little messy. I like the 100 BT better. I like the Reloader 19 for the 100 grain and either Varget or H4350 on the 75 grainers. Out of a 26" barrel they were traveling around 3700 fps. It doesn't take long to hit a coyote at 400+ yards.

Both of those rifles are scary accurate with either the 115 NBT or the 85 NBT. Neither one really shines with the 100 for some reason, OK but not great. I guess if I was strictly using it for coyotes I might go with the 85, but the 115 shoots just as good and has a better BC. Both me and my friend shoot the 115 for everything and just don't worry about it. Dad also like the old Plain Jane 100 grain Hornady too. He killed over 250 coyotes with that Savage 25-06 of his.
